PRECAUTIONS
The installation and commissioning of this equipment shall be carried out by professional electrical maintenance personnel who are familiar with the structure and operation of the device. Failure to follow this precaution could result in bodily harm. Do not connect this equipment to a consumer utility line box, such as a home line. Keep the inverter away from water, and avoid dropping water on the machine or getting it up. Do not insert or pull the plug with wet hands. Keep the inverter in a cool environment, suitable temperature should be -20 ° C – 40 ° C, and avoid direct sunlight and hot vents. Keep the inverter away from flammable materials or where flammable gases accumulate. After prolonged use, the inverter will heat up, so avoid getting close to heat-sensitive substances. Make sure the vents are smooth and well cooled. Do not open the machine due to high voltage danger. Use a suitable type of wire to avoid blowing the wire due to excessive inverter current. Make sure the inverter is connected to the correct battery, otherwise the fuse of the inverter will be blown. Turn off the switch when the machine is not in use. Please turn off the switch before cleaning and dean it with a dry cloth. Do not use a damp cloth or detergent.

Protective function
- Low-voltage alarm: The buzzer sounds 2 audible with a 1 Hz gap.
- Low voltage protection: The buzzer continuously sounds 3 times alarm, with Hz gaps
- Low-voltage recovery: the low-voltage rise automatically restores the output, and the buzzer sounds 3 times alarm is canceled.
- Overvoltage protection: The buzzer sounds 4 times, with a 1 Hz gap.
- Overvoltage recovery: The voltage is reduced automatically to restore the output, and the buzzer sounds 4times alarm is canceled.
- thermal protection: 80 ° ±5 °, when overheating protection buzzer sounds 5times alarm, withlhz gap
- Overload protection: 105 automatic shutdown output for overload protection, 55 automatic recoveries, automatic locking for three consecutive times
- Short circuit protection: Output short circuit protection 15 shutdown lock.
- The input is reversed the fuse is blown.

USE ENVIRONMENT
Install the inverter according to local power requirements. The installation location must be dry, clean and well ventilated. Working temperature : -20°C to 40°C Storage temperature : -10 to 40°C Relative humidity : 0%-90%, no condensation Cooling: forced ventilation
WIRING REQUIREMENTS
1-meter long battery line configuration requirements.
POWER | DC INPUT | WIRE DIAMETER |
---|---|---|
600W | 12V | 10AWG |
600W | 24/48V | 12AWG |
1000W | 12V | 7AWG |
1000W | 24/48V | 10AWG |
2000W | 12V | 4AWG |
2000W | 24/48V | 7AWG |
3000W | 12V | 2AWG |
3000W | 24/48V | 4AWG |
4000W | 12V | 1AWG |
4000W | 24/48V | 4AWG |
5000W | 12V | 2AWG*2 |
5000W | 24/48V | 4AWG |

The inverter may be affected by some strong electromagnetic waves in the use, such as nearby motors, power inverters, strong magnetic fields, etc Inverter indicator is not light
1. The battery and inverter are not connected and reconnected.
2. The pole of the battery is reversed and the fuse is blown. Replace the fuse. -
Low output voltage
1. Overload, the load current exceeds the nominal current, and some of the load is turned off to restart.
2. The input voltage is too low. Make sure the input voltage is within the nominal voltage range. -
Low voltage alarm
1. The battery is out of power and needs to be charged.
2. If The battery voltage is too low or the contact is poor, recharge, check the battery terminals, or clean the terminals with a dry cloth. -
The inverter has no output
1. If the battery voltage is too low, recharge or replace the battery.
2. The load current is too high, and some of the load is turned off to restart the inverter.
3. Inverter over-temperature protection. Allow the inverter to cool for a while and place it in a well-ventilated area.
4. The inverter failed to start and restarted.
5. The terminal is reversed, the fuse is blown, and the fuse is replaced.
